HS Code 2912 — Aldehydes and Cyclic Polymers
Covers organic compounds containing a functional group with the structure -CHO. This group includes essential industrial chemicals like formaldehyde, as well as aromatic aldehydes used in the flavour and fragrance industry.
What's included
- Formaldehyde
- Acetaldehyde
- Benzaldehyde
- Paraformaldehyde
- Ethylvanillin

Frequently asked questions
How is formaldehyde usually shipped?
It is commonly shipped as 'Formalin', an aqueous solution typically containing 37% formaldehyde and a stabilizer like methanol.
